The libretto of Untitled Coast was written across the same Provincetown season that produced the canvases on this page, set in the weeks after the harbor empties and the town goes quiet. A question runs through both: what does a coast remember, once the boats leave and the streets fill with strangers? Below is a public excerpt from the opening act, paired with the four paintings closest to it.
The harbor keeps a different clock in summer.
The boats carry names that no one here knows.
I walked the breakwater for the cold,
to come back inside a different person.
The light at five stays at five for forty minutes.
I counted it on the wall above the work.
The painting came back softer than I left it,
as if the coast had asked it to slow down.
